I'm finally going to take my bloodwork at 8:30a.m. today. One year ago, my cholesterol was over 300, I had high blood pressure (which now is normal), I developed GASTRITIS (which is now gone), and I was even actually placed on cholesterol lowering drugs (statins), water pills, and blood pressure medications (which I quit after taking for a month because I HATE drugs and refused to believe that I couldn't do this with eating healthy and exercise). To make matters worse, my Vitamin D count was only 7.5 (supposed to be at least 35)!:eek: I had to take 50,000 btu of vit. D for 5 months! I was in pretty bad shape.

It will be interesting to see how my body (internally) has changed with 5 months of healthy eating and moderate exercise. Stay tuned....

Heres The oatmeal bar recipe. I subbed the applesauce with crushed pineapple and add thin slices of apple. now I cooked this in a 8 x 11 glass baking dish.and cooked till the top was crisp, but when I cut them after cooled the bottom was soggyish. so I cut them up flipped
them over and baked them again till they crisped up. I was thinking about tring them in muffin tin, The glass baking dish might have had some thing to do with it. They aren't to bad and heather then the processed stuff. Its one of those recipes to tweak till you find it the way you like it. I am also going to try and bake like a cookie and see how that goes maybe get a little crisper that way.




2 cup uncooked oatmeal
1 1/2 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p table salt
1 cup fat-free skim milk
2 eggs
1/2 cup unsweetened applesauce
1/4 cup Splenda
1 tsp vanilla extract
1 tsp ground cinnamon ( I add more(at least 1T)or use apple pie spice)
Add banana or berries if you like,

Preheat oven to 350* Combine wet ingredients and add dry ingredients.
Bake in sprayed 8" square pan for 35-45 minutes or in muffin tins for 20 minutes.
Keeps well in refrig. or freezer. It's good cold or warm
